Bloom360 Learning Community is a 501 (c)(3) non-profit school in southeastern Wisconsin for children with neuro-diverse needs.

Success Story: Emma

“Chicken Dance?” Emma expresses her joy through rhythm and music. She has a few favorite songs that she requests often and invites others to dance and sing along with her as a way of connecting with her people. Emma is a Learner in our Roots program and is in her fourth year at Bloom360. Emma recently stated that the best part of Bloom360 is being part of our community! At Bloom360 Emma has a deep sense of belonging and acceptance that allows her to thrive in her learning!

Emma’s favorite experience this year so far was our Bloom360 Glow Star Party held in collaboration with GLAS (Geneva Lake Astrophysics and STEAM – Education Center). Surrounded by her peers, learning guides and family members, Emma was glowing as she held the world in her hands and gave direction to the sun all while surrounded by her Bloom360 community! Emma’s energy was contagious and inspiring that evening. Emma engaged with her heart, body and lively spirit.

In preparation for the Glow Star Party Emma replicated a few star constellations with marshmallows and toothpicks.  Using fine motor, building and problem-solving skills this activity took patience, perseverance and determination which Emma embraced with a bright smile on her face. When Emma first began at Bloom360 engaging in activities like these were very challenging and overwhelming but over time being supported socially and emotionally by our trusted caring team, Emma’s sense of belonging grew – nurturing her confidence and her ability to take on greater challenges that are just right for her.
